Apple Bay

Tortola, British Virgin Islands
🪸Sharp reef

Apple Bay is the British Virgin Islands' most consistent surf spot—a reef break on Tortola's north shore that picks up more swell than anywhere else in the territory. When winter swells arrive, clean, fast waves peel along the reef, drawing the small but dedicated BVI surf community.

Frequently Asked Questions

What tide is best at Apple Bay?

Apple Bay works best on a mid to high tide, ideally between 0.6m and 1.8m on the local tide chart. The tide chart above shows today’s strike window.

What wind direction is offshore at Apple Bay?

Offshore wind at Apple Bay blows from the SE (135°). Anything in the 100° to 170° range grooms the faces; outside it, expect chop or bumpy conditions.

What swell size and direction work best at Apple Bay?

Apple Bay wants NNW swell (310° to 10°) between 0.8m and 2.5m, with a period of 14s or more for quality waves.

When is the best time of year to surf Apple Bay?

The main season at Apple Bay is Nov, Dec, Jan, Feb, Mar. A secondary window runs Sep, Oct. Winter swells. Most consistent spot in BVI.

How do I get to Apple Bay?

Fly into EIS, then allow about 15 minutes by road. Tortola north shore. BVI surf hub.

What kind of wave is Apple Bay?

Apple Bay is a reef break, a peak with lefts and rights. Difficulty is rated 5/10.
